Understanding Private ADHD Diagnosis in the UK
Attention Deficit Hyperactivity Disorder (ADHD) is a neurodevelopmental condition that impacts both kids and adults. Symptoms often consist of problems in maintaining attention, spontaneous actions, and hyperactivity. While the National Health Service (NHS) supplies ADHD assessments, numerous individuals choose for private diagnosis due to different factors such as waiting times, gain access to, and preference for specific health care experts. Healthcare specialists in the UK typically follow the Diagnostic and Statistical Manual of Mental Disorders (DSM-5) or the International Classification of Diseases (ICD-10/ ICD-11) requirements for detecting ADHD. A formal diagnosis generally needs:
Evidence of Symptoms Present in Two or More Settings: Symptoms should be observable in the house and in schools or workplaces.Medical Significance: Symptoms must hinder or lower the quality of social, academic, or occupational performance.Follow-Up Sessions

While looking for a private diagnosis uses benefits, the associated costs can be substantial. Below is an approximate breakdown of potential expenses:
ServiceEstimated CostPreliminary Consultation₤ 150 - ₤ 300Follow-Up Appointment₤ 75 - ₤ 200Diagnostic Tests₤ 100 - ₤ 400Medication (if recommended)Variable, depending on medication and dose
It is important for patients to examine if their insurance coverage covers any of these expenses or if payment plans are readily available.
Benefits of a Private ADHD Diagnosis
There are a number of benefits to selecting a private adhd diagnosis Uk ADHD diagnosis:
Reduced Waiting Times: Private assessments can lead to a quicker diagnosis as they typically circumvent the long waiting lists connected with NHS services.More Personalised Attention: Patients may gain from more individualised care, due to lower patient-to-doctor ratios.Greater Flexibility: Private service providers might provide more flexible visit times, consisting of nights and weekends.Access to Specialist Services: Professionals in private practice frequently have specific know-how in ADHD, causing an in-depth and nuanced understanding of the condition.Downsides of a Private ADHD Diagnosis
However, there are likewise disadvantages to think about:
Cost Implications: The monetary problem might be significant, particularly for continuous treatment or therapy.Lack of Continuity of Care: Some patients may not have a clear follow-up plan post-diagnosis, specifically if additional services are not provided.Variability in Quality: The quality of care can vary considerably between private practices, making it important to research study thoroughly before picking a supplier.Common FAQsWhat is ADHD?
